Top 10 Best Idaho Vocational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 14 vocational public schools serving 510 students in Idaho.
Vocational schools offer a series of courses which directly prepare individuals in paid or unpaid employment in jobs that have requirements other than a baccalaureate or advanced degree.
The top ranked vocational public schools in Idaho are Meridian Technical Charter High School, Meridian Medical Arts Charter and Technical Careers High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Idaho vocational public schools have an average math proficiency score of 55% (versus the Idaho public school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 54%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 20%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Idaho public school average of 26% (majority Hispanic).
